Perguntas sobre 'read'

0
respostas

Alta iowait enquanto a taxa de transferência e IOPS estão baixos

Sou novo em programação & Linux. Depois que eu terminei meus programas (faço algumas IOs), descobri que o iowait é muito alto (~ 65%) enquanto o throughput (~ 5M / s lê + ~ 5M / s escreve) e IOPS (50 ~ 100 QPS) baixo. iostat -xm 1 r...
28.08.2017 / 13:37
1
resposta

Não é possível ler o arquivo normal - bloco de operações de E / S

Estou escrevendo um programa que analisa todos os arquivos em um dispositivo Android, procurando por uma string específica. Alguns segundos durante o processo, fico preso no seguinte arquivo: / sys / power / wakelock_count Eu tentei usar...
16.07.2017 / 16:02
1
resposta

Python 'read -n1 var'?

Existe um módulo do Python 3 que permite inserir um único caractere, sem ter que pressionar Enter depois? Like Bash's read -n1 var ?     
05.07.2016 / 10:50
0
respostas

avaliando comandos de bloqueio duplo em uma instrução de condição bash

Estou tentando gravar um loop que atualiza um terminal: 1. quando o (s) arquivo (s) foi modificado (s) ou 2. Quando a entrada do usuário é detectada no segundo intervalo. Eu sei como fazer um de cada vez, assim: while inotifywait -q -e mofid...
06.07.2016 / 16:46
0
respostas

A gravação aleatória no benchmark DISK mostra uma alta taxa de leitura no iostat

Estou executando um benchmark de gravação aleatória diretamente em alguns discos (HDD e SDD) e estou recebendo alguns dados de saída estranhos no monitor iostat. Além da taxa de gravação usual, há uma taxa de leitura que não consigo entender por...
21.03.2016 / 14:01
3
respostas

Imprimindo uma linha em um deslocamento especificado em um arquivo

Eu tenho um arquivo com 50 caracteres em cada linha e 50 linhas. Cada linha do arquivo contém letras arbitrárias. Quero especificar um número de seqüência de caracteres (ex: 52) e ter a linha de letras apropriada impressa com um * impresso na...
03.11.2015 / 18:08
0
respostas

Respondendo aos prompts automaticamente?

Digamos que eu tenha um script chamado RPS que simule uma tesoura de papel de pedra. Por exemplo, digamos que eu execute o script com "$ sh RPS". O script irá ecoar "paper" e, em seguida, solicitar uma entrada. Obviamente, se eu digitar "teso...
15.04.2015 / 22:48
2
respostas

Por que 'ler' não pega todos os meus vars?

Minhas desculpas pela pergunta básica, mas alguém pode ajudar a explicar por que o seguinte não foi impresso 3 2 1 6 5 4? echo '1 2 3 4 5 6' | while read a b c; do echo result: $c b a; done Os três primeiros números não seriam lidos em or...
24.04.2016 / 21:11
2
respostas

Verificação de uma linha lida [fechada]

Eu tenho essa operação read : read -p "Please enter your name:" username Como posso verificar o nome dos usuários em uma linha? Se não for possível de maneira sã em uma linha, talvez uma função Bash colocada dentro de uma variável se...
05.02.2018 / 03:29
3
respostas

Como obter o número de palavras dadas como entrada em um comando “read”?

Para o seguinte comando, como saber quantas palavras são dadas na entrada? $ read text Eu gostaria de pegar uma nova variável que contará o número de palavras dadas para o "texto". Como por exemplo se, $ read text apple A variável,...
12.09.2016 / 01:04